    40A, COCKERELL CLOSE, WIMBORNE, BH21 1XT

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Cockerell Close last sold in October 2009 for £125,000. Based on price growth in the BH21 district since then, its estimated current value is £179,576 — placing it in the 19th percentile nationally and the 4th percentile within BH21. The property covers 80 m² (861 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,245 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    BH21 covers the Wimborne and Ferndown areas in east Dorset, lying between Bournemouth and the New Forest. It is a predominantly suburban and semi-rural district with strong appeal to families and older buyers seeking space and quieter surroundings.
